Research has found that regular activity or exercise accounted for significantly longer telomeres and those longer telomeres found in active adults accounted for the cellular equivalent of being 9 years younger

The stronger you are as you age, the less likely you are to get #Alzheimers disease. Resistance training helps prevent cognitive decline and benefits people with mild cognitive impairment
